When Larry Page was still at Stanford, he noticed that search engines at the time had no other way of assessing the top quality and integrity of sites. That's when he created PageRank, which determines the high quality and integrity of a website based on the variety of back links it has from other premium sites.
Simply as a scholastic cites relied on journals and publications to back up their claims, so also ought to sites with back links. Consequently, backlinks act as 'integrity votes' for the high quality of your web site. Let's take into consideration a simple instance. To put it simply, a back links from the video gaming web site Steam will not do a lot for a blog site about knitting. Both markets are totally unconnected, and a link from one site to the other adds no worth to customers (and will likely only result in confusion/frustration). This is why relevance is a huge offer for back links.
Relevance can also take numerous forms, consisting of: Topical relevance. If another internet site takes care of the very same subject, such as knitting, then it holds topical relevance. Contextual significance. It's also important to remember that significance can be contextual. For instance, typically, a link from The Wall surface Street Times to a knitting blog wouldn't be pertinent at all.

Complicating things even more is the reality that Google makes use of priority indexing. This indicates that they reindex prominent, frequently checked out internet sites one of the most while various other websites need to wait a number of weeks or months to get crawled again.
